Family of 4 (2 kids age 7 and 9) will be stopping at this port next spring.  Any suggestions on activities that would keep all of us interested?  Looking at RC and non-RC excursions; my preference is to book through the ship but seeing the inflated prices I can easily be persuaded to book elsewhere.  Not too interested in snorkeling though - been there done that.

If you have never done any of the Mayan ruins from Belize (Altun Ha comes to mind) I would definitely recommend those. It's a very long day but well worth the time.

 

We went on a combination river "cruise" and Mayan ruin trip which was one of the best excursions I have ever been on. I was as sick as a dog (bad cold) but I still thoroughly enjoyed it.

 

I will say...this (Mayan ruin or river cruise) is another situation where I would NOT recommend going on a non-RCI excursion. Even though the prices may be high-ish for the RCI-sponsored trips, these distant and lengthy excursions are just too high risk, IMO, to do with a non-RCI vendor. I'm sure they are very reputable but there are just waaaytooo many things that can go wrong with a trip that far from the ship.

 

Belize City is another of those places where I would not necessarily recommend aimless meandering. Belize City is a dirty, crowded, poor city with very little in the way of walkable points of interest. I do NOT meant to suggest that it isn't safe. I have never felt unsafe there...there's just not that much of interest in the city itself. If you're not interested in beach stuff then I think the Mayan ruins and/or the river excursion would be great. I loved them both !

Totally agree with WAAAYTOOO, I just did that excursion last week and loved it. The river portion was fun, seen howler monkeys, alligators, iguanas in trees and birds.

That said I found we spent too much time on river and not enough at ruins.

And aside from the security of not missing the ship another good reason to book through Royal is they put you on the first tender and you get to wait in the theater.

And I agree about Belize city, very run down. The drive back to the ship was draw dropping, these people have nothing and get no support. No effort at all to make things look decent. Although I hear some of their islands are very good places to live.

I read on the Tripadvisor forums that the tender ride to Belize port is 20 minutes and this means the tender queues are much longer - so it's best to do a RCI trip as they get you off first. We've actually booked a snorkelling trip that collects you directly from the ship - which seemed like a good idea to save time. The ruins do look good though if you like that type of thing!
